Anyone else notice how it was marketed as a light-hearted superhero comedy of sorts, but as soon as Christopher Nolan and Warner Brothers started divulging information about The Dark Knight and more details about Heath Ledger's performance in that film started to come about, Hancock was suddenly billed as a serious character study?

That alone was enough to set of the warning bells for me. When a film's promotional campaigns change as a knee-jerk reaction to a rival film - not that Hancock was ever in the same league as The Dark Knight - it's always a bad sign.
